Facebook: / greatscottlab Twitter: / greatscottlab Support me for more videos: https://www.patreon.com/GreatScott?ty=h You can get an eFuse here: (affiliate link) https://s.click.aliexpress.com/e/_APh7dh In this electronics basics episode we will have a closer look at eFuse ICs. They offer a ton of protection features for a very small price tag. That is why I will show you how I used such an eFuse in my LiPo Supercharger project and how you can use it for pretty much every electronics project. The included protection features are the following: undervoltage, overvoltage, reverse voltage, overcurrent and short circuit current. Let's get started! Thanks to JLCPCB for sponsoring this video.
